    A distinguished American author of the late nineteenth and early twentieth centuries,Harriet Prescott Spofford (1835 - 1921) is generally remembered for her gothic novels, poems, and detective stories. Spofford started writing for the purpose of supporting her family, particularly her invalid parents. In a Cellar, published inAtlantic Monthly brought her instant fame. ;
